Roger G Bourbeau 1910 - 1986

Roger G Bourbeau of Palmyra, Lebanon County, PA was born on August 2, 1910, and died at age 75 years old on April 23, 1986. Roger Bourbeau was buried at Indiantown Gap National Cemetery Section 12-B Site 569 Rr2, Box 484 - Indiantown Gap Road, in Annville.
